First two are almost similar, Last one from mainframegurukul covers most of the jcl These will guide us through the Cobol DB2 Application Programming. COBOL Tutorial for Beginners – Learn COBOL in simple and easy steps starting from basic to advanced concepts with examples including Overview. VSAM is used by COBOL and CICS in Mainframes to store and retrieve data. VSAM makes it easier for application programs to execute an input-output.

Author: Makree Bakinos
Country: Oman
Language: English (Spanish)
Genre: Literature
Published (Last): 16 June 2013
Pages: 15
PDF File Size: 14.87 Mb
ePub File Size: 19.46 Mb
ISBN: 709-2-29423-833-9
Downloads: 59493
Price: Free* [*Free Regsitration Required]
Uploader: Kagataxe

We’ll introduce you to the hardware and peripherals. We’ll introduce you to the hardware and peripherals.

The source data sets are not cataloged. By using this site, you agree to the Terms of Use and Privacy Policy. Lookup tables save processing time by searching for an input x and finding the output y from the table, rather than do an expensive computation. To many people who are thrown to work at a mainframe computer on their first job, they feel lost.

Keys can be located anywhere in the record and do not have to be contiguous. This is very cumbersome. Usually SORT can choose the optimal technique, but this can be overridden by the user.

Format and print the system job queue. Retrieved April 2, In the example above, SYSIN control cards are coming from an in-stream file, but you can instead point to any sequential file or a PDS member containing control cards or a temporary data-set, if you wish. When there are multiple items of the same type, you can use arrays.

This example shows how you can code static and dynamic calls.

COBOL Data Items

Mainframeturukul more than one step mainframegurukjl is specified, the entire namelist must be enclosed in parentheses. From Wikipedia, the free encyclopedia. Code that uses a static call to call a subprogram Code that uses a dynamic call to call the same subprogram The mmainframegurukul that is called by the two types of calls The following example shows how you would code static calls: Setting an index to 2, will cause the compiler to correctly calculate the byte offset and point to the 2 nd element in the table.


Multiple tapes may be labeled in one run of the utility. IBM categorizes some of these programs as utilities [1] [a] and others as service aids [2] ; the boundaries are not always consistent or obvious. International readers based in the US and other countries can click here to purchase the e-book.

It consisted initially as a single instruction a “Branch to Register” Views Read Edit View history.

COBOL Tutorial

These values can be coded:. Any combination of these may be used in one namelist.

The elements of a table could be elementary or group data items. The binder performs the same functions as the Linkage Editor. For example, you could create a table of employee SSN and their names. Stand-alone program to format and print the system job queue.

Mainframe people seem to speak a completely different language and that doesn’t make life easy. In any given execution of mainframegyrukul called program and either of the two calling programs, if the values within RECORD-1 are changed between the coobl of the first CALL and the mainramegurukul, the values passed at the time of the second CALL statement will be the changed, not the original, values.

A COBOL table mainframsgurukul array is simply a data structure consisting of a collection of elements valuesall of which have the same data description, such as a table of monthly sales.


Initialize the index I to 1. See here for more info: Not applicable to MVS. Select the orders that are 90 days and older: Each tape will be rewound and unloaded after being labeled.

In this example, data set maibframegurukul. Other statements allow the user to specify which records should be included or excluded from the sort and specify other transformations to be performed on the data.

It can also select or exclude specified members during the copy operation, and rename or replace members. These utilities are normally used by systems programmers in maintaining the operation of the system, rather than by programmers in doing application work on the system.

It was originally available in several configurations depending on storage requirement, but the E level Linkage Editor is no longer available and the F level Linkage Editor is now known simply as the Linkage Editor.

Each programming language used in a computer shop will have one or more associated compilers that translate a source program into a machine-language object module. For example, the sales in June i.

Think of a maintramegurukul as a matrixa grid of elements. Control statements define the fields of the records to be created, including position, length, format, and mainframdgurukul to be performed. IBM mainframe operating systems Utility software.

I then construct an array out of this variable by slicing it into twelve parts. Readers based in Indiacan buy the e-book for Rs. Readers based in Indiacan buy the e-book for Rs. As an example, let’s assume that a bank’s customer accounts information is stored in a table.